Easy Star Pillow Pattern

Make a cute star pillow in about 15 minutes with fabric scraps and other basic sewing supplies. A fun sewing project for the Fourth of July, or any time of the year!
Total Time15 minutes
Yield: 1 Pillow

Equipment

  • Washable Ink Pen
  • Sewing Machine
  • Point Turning Tool
  • Iron
  • Hand Sewing Needle

Materials

  • Star Pillow Pattern
  • Fabric for Pillow Front and Back
  • Coordinating Thread
  • Fiber Fill

Instructions

  • To begin, print the PDF star pillow pattern. Follow the instructions on the pattern printout to assemble the pattern piece.
  • For each star pillow, use the pattern to cut out a front and a back star piece. (You can use the same fabric for front and back, or two different fabrics.) Helpful Tip: Use the washable ink pen to make a small mark on the top point of each star piece to help align the pieces correctly in the upcoming step.
    Star Pillow Pieces
  • If you would like to add iron-on vinyl wording or any other detail to the front of your pillow, use your Cricut to cut out that design and heat press it to the pillow front piece now before moving on to the next step.
  • Line the two fabric pieces up, right sides facing, so that the marked points are aligned. Pin.
    Pin Star Pillow Pieces Together
  • Using a 1/4" seam allowance, stitch around the perimeter of the pillow, leaving a 1.5" opening for turning.
  • Use sewing shears to carefully clip the points and notches around the star shape.
    Notch Corners of Star Pillow Before Turning Right Side Out
  • Turn the piece right-side out through the opening, using a seam turning tool to help get the points of the star pillow nice and crisp. IMPORTANT: Press the turned pillow nice and flat, making sure to fold in the seams of the unstitched opening toward the inside of the pillow so they line up with the stitched pillow seam.
  • Stuff fiber fill into the pillow through the unstitched opening, adding a little bit of the fiber fill at a time to ensure the pillow is evenly stuffed. Use the seam turning tool to poke the stuffing into the star points first before filling up the center of the star. Fill the star with stuffing until your desired firmness.
    Stuff Fiber Fill into Star Pillow
  • Finally, hand stitch the pillow opening shut with a needle and thread.
